Abstract

fetched live from OpenAlex

The Hurricane Mountain mélange, Maine, marks the suture zone between the suspected Boundary Mountain and Gander terranes. To the west the Hurricane Mountain mélange is bounded by the Boil Mountain ophiolite complex, and on the southeast it is overlain by the Dead River flysch. This ophiolite- mélange -flysch sequence may mark a terrane suture that trends northeast from the northern New Hampshire border across west-central Maine and into New Brunswick.
 
 The matrix of the Hurricane Mountain mélange includes mafic volcanic, felsic volcanic, metasedimentary and serpentinitc blocks Major and trace element analysis of the igneous blocks in mélange shows strong geochemical similarities to mafic volcanic, felsic volcanic and ultramafic units of the Boil Mountain ophiolite complex. Analysis of relict clinopyroxene grains further supports a correlation between the mafic mélange blocks and the upper mafic unit of the Boil Mountain ophiolite complex. Overall, the field, petrographic, and geochemical data suggest that the Boil Mountain ophiolite complex is the probable source for the exotic blocks in the Hurricane Mountain mélange.
 
 RÉSUMÉ
 Le mélange du mont Hurricane, au Maine, marque la zone de suture entre les terranes présumés du mont Boundary et de Gander. À l'ouest. Ic mélange du mont Hurricane est limité par le cortège ophiolitique du mont Boil, et à partir du sud-ouest, il est rccouvert par le flysch de la rivière Dead Ce cortège ophiolite-mélange-flysch pourrait marquer un terrane de suture orienté vers le nord-csi à partir de la frontière septentrionale du New Hampshire et traversant le centre-ouest du Maine jusqu'a 1'interieurdu Nouveau-Brunswick
 
 Les blocs a l'interieur de la matricc du mélange du mont Hurricane comprennent des roches volcanomafiques, des roches volcanofelsiques. des blocs métasedimentaires et des serpentinites. Les analyses des elements majeure et des éléments traces des blocs du mélange révèlent des similarités géochimiques marquees avec les unites volcanomafiques, volcanofelsiques et ultramafiques du cortege ophiolithique du mont Boil. Une analyse de grains de clinopyroxene résiduels appuie elle aussi une corrélation entre les blocs du mélange mafique et l'unité mafique supérieure du cortége ophiolitique du mont Boil. En somme les données de terrain et les données pétrographiques et géochimiques laissent supposer que le cortège ophiolitique du mont Boil constitue la source probable des blocs du mélange exotique du mont Hurricane
